Transaction 5cc6e421dd727a40d1063746369aedc2f4269a364856d66dfa208cf395966494

2 Input
2 Outputs
  • 5cc6e421dd727a40d1063746369aedc2f4269a364856d66dfa208cf395966494:0
  • value  511555
    address  3EDumd3qdVrzqLJDZUrW8hgNLf7PEzL1Zk
  • 5cc6e421dd727a40d1063746369aedc2f4269a364856d66dfa208cf395966494:1
  • value  68102
    address  bc1q6vhv2kthqgr7d9vp8fj8d8qndzxrc63qpr8hk7